MOMS: a multi-optical approach for land mine detection

Abstract: The objective of this paper is to present the Swedish land mine and UXO detection project named "Multi Optical Mine Detection System", MOMS. Research and investigations carried out within the MOMS project during the first year will be described. Activities have mainly been focused on basic principles, phenomena, acquisition of knowledge and literature studies. The paper introduces the reader with the aim of the project and then the initial and future work is presented.

“…As a part of the MOMS (Multi-optical mine detection system) project [1,2], a field trial was conducted at the Swedish EOD and Demining Centre (SWEDEC) in May 2005. The purpose of this initial field trial was to collect data on surface laid mines, UXO, submunitions, IED's, and background with a variety of optical sensors.…”
